The Edison and Ford Winter Estates. (CREDIT: WINK News) The Edison and Ford Winter Estates in Fort Myers will remain closed Friday due to the impacts of Hurricane Milton, including area power outages. The site originally announced it would close on October 7 with plans to reopen Oct. 11, weather permitting. “We are cleaning up debris and plan to re-open very soon,” said Lisa Wilson, marketing and public relations director. “Once we know when we’ll be able to open, we’ll post information on our social media channels and on our website.” The Orchid Sale and Symposium that had been scheduled for this weekend has been rescheduled too. The event is now set for April 12-13 and will be combined with the springtime Grow Fort Myers event. The Edison and Ford Winter Estates has yet to provide a timeline for reopening, but the museum did advise people to check their website at EdisonFord.org or social media for updates.
